Latest Patents
One of Hashimoto's latest patents is a deposition method and apparatus designed to enhance step coverage of a coating film. This invention utilizes a deposition apparatus that includes a first electrode, a second electrode, a first power supply source, a second power supply source, and a phase adjuster. The first power supply source features a high-frequency power source and a matching circuit, which work together to output high-frequency power. The second power supply source also includes a matching circuit that outputs a lower frequency power, synchronized with the first. The invention aims to optimize the voltage and capacitance values in relation to the phase difference, ensuring efficient operation. Additionally, Hashimoto has developed a target assembly that prevents abnormal discharging and ensures the bonding material remains contained, facilitating easier reuse of the backing plate.
